Railway Employee Pass: People often wonder whether railway employees can travel for free on every train. While railway employees are generally provided with various pass facilities for travel, this does not mean they are permitted to travel for free on every single train. Recently, Railway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w provided information in Parliament regarding the pass facilities available to railway employees and the associated rules.
Under the Railway Servants (Pass) Rules, 1986, railway employees are issued various types of passes. These include facilities such as Privilege Passes, Duty Passes, and Complimentary Passes granted after retirement. Both the employees and their eligible family members can avail the benefits of these passes to travel on specific trains.
On which trains are railway passes valid?
Railway employee passes are valid on several premium trains, including:
Vande Bharat Express
Rajdhani Express
Shatabdi Express
Duronto Express
Hamsafar Express
Gatimaan Express
According to the Railways, Vande Bharat and Gatimaan Express are considered equivalent to Shatabdi-class trains. However, the class in which an employee can travel depends on their rank, pay level, and eligibility.
On which trains is free travel not available?
Railway passes do not apply to every train. Employees cannot use this facility at all on luxury and tourist trains. These include:
Maharajas' Express
Palace on Wheels
These trains are primarily operated by entities such as IRCTC and state tourism development corporations. No special provisions under railway pass rules are extended to employees for these trains. In such cases, railway employees travel by purchasing tickets just like ordinary passengers.
What is the complete rule?
The Railways has stated that employees are entitled to pass facilities only on trains covered under the regulations; consequently, they are not permitted to travel on every train. They are required to purchase tickets for luxury and tourism-oriented trains. Additionally, when traveling using a Privilege Ticket Order (PTO), railway employees must pay a portion of the fare—approximately one-third of the cost.
